Output ecd6390d18cb37591642e6155d0e631e21eba110584084429cac1cb3e7595e68:0

value
37060662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9539ad518daa6f998f40d3097b9ef475411fa920 OP_EQUAL
address
3FJ3hbYpxNJbU8YLpafHpuPTcQvvirUbAs
transaction
ecd6390d18cb37591642e6155d0e631e21eba110584084429cac1cb3e7595e68
spent
true